BlackVue has been present on the Russian market since 2013, with about 80 percent of the market in the segment “from 20 thousand rubles”. That is, four out of five premium autoreggs sold in Russia bear the “stigma” of BlackVue. In Korea, the situation is even better for the company: there it is the undisputed market leader, selling more than a million devices per year (the total market volume of auto regs in Russia, by the way, in 2015 did not exceed 2.5 million in units). BlackVue products are also sold in the USA, the UK and several other European countries.
The registrars are assembled in their own factories; a team of fifty professional engineers is responsible for the development. This is you, damn it, not 4-5 Chinese after technical vocational schools - such “teams of pain and despair” usually stand behind the Chinese auto regs. With relevant results ... ')
Among the know-how developed in BlackVue, it is worthwhile to single out a cylindrical form factor for recorders - for the first time it appeared in BlackVue models. Later, this rather successful form was copied by both Chinese and less eminent Koreans - ThinkWare, FineVu, Cowon (yes, the latter has long been engaged not only in MP3 players).
Another know-how of BlackVue, already this year, 2016 is cloud services, which allow to turn the recorder into an auto-alarm system and a full-featured tracking system for the car, plus conduct live video transmissions of the video recorded by the recorder to the Internet. This is not found in any other DVRs of any other manufacturers - only in the top BlackVue family DR650S.

The B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S, like most other BlackVue models, is cylindrical. Material - plastic, the assembly is very neat. In general, the ideal fit of the panels in the recorders is rare, and it was more pleasant to see it here.
The lens is on the front panel, which is logical. Below it is an LED that notifies the user that the recorder is recording.
On the side that looks at the salon, there are indicators of GPS and video, as well as the speaker. Since there is no screen in the B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S, the speaker plays a particularly important role: it is with its help that messages about the activation of certain modes of operation are reproduced - for example, “the recording has started”. System alerts are reproduced in a pleasant female voice, and in Russian. It's nice that in Korea they attended to the thorough Russification of the device.
On the right side of the case is a lid with a hole that opens access to the power ports and connect an external GPS receiver. If you move the cover to the side, we will see a slot for a memory card. However, there are chips with protection of a memory card and quite practical application - when companies with their own fleet (whether passenger or freight traffic) need to seal the slot and deprive drivers and unauthorized persons of independent unauthorized access to microSD. Here, such a scenario sounds already goraazdo more realistic.
There are air vents on the bottom side of the case - in this case you can't do without them, because the case of the B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S is very compact (length is 116 mm, diameter is 34 mm) and the iron is very serious, otherwise it would not be possible to achieve this quality video.
Accordingly, the active cooling of this powerful iron is necessary. Here, on the bottom, is a microphone.
The holder on the windshield looks like a ring with a pad on which 3M adhesive tape is attached. The recorder is inserted into the ring until it clicks, and is removed after pressing the button. B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S can be rotated in a ring around its axis, aiming the autoreg on the road. To make it convenient for the user to remember the correct position, there are several serifs on the ring.
At the same time, the recorder can be turned in the ring in such a way that it looks at the salon. This is relevant for recording a conversation with a traffic police officer who sat in the passenger seat. But to unfold the B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S sideways, to the driver's door, alas, will not work. Well, there’s nothing to complain about, if you chose the Korean recorders, the specificity of models from this country almost never assumes any twists in the mount left or right.
External GPS-receiver and in size, and in appearance resembles pedometers like the Xiaomi Mi Band. Thin cable and, in general, the external design of the module allows you to easily place it where you want it, well, or where the radiotransparent area is on the heated windshield. Well, do not forget that the external design is also good because it provides better communication with satellites - there is no interference from the inside of the recorder, as is often the case when the GPS navigation module is installed inside the case.

The B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S stuffing made the most pleasant impression: there were no traces of sloppy soldering, inscriptions with a marker on the board, glue leaks and other signs of the Chinese deshman here and there is no trace. Everything is very neat - like the insides of an iPhone or Samsung top smartphones. Please note that the RAM modules are made by Samsung - and this also suggests that the developers did not save on the components, since the RAM from the Korean manufacturer costs much more than its Chinese counterparts and differs in significantly higher quality.
On the board, there is an indication of Pittasoft, the parent company of BlackVue; This, in turn, suggests that the board is proprietary, it was not ordered from a third company. To understand: even the Taiwanese Mio, not the last player in terms of technology player of the recorder market, does not always create the board itself.
Mio MiVue 588 - there is no mention of the brand as a developer on the board.
In addition, please note - judging by the inscription, the motherboard is designed specifically for the BlackVue DR450-1CH, it is not some kind of universal platform for Chinese noname-developers.

Functionality and settings
B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S is configured only from a computer using the BlackVue Viewer program, which exists in the versions for Windows and macOS. Support for the latest OS pleases, as registrar developers usually ignore it. But from a mobile device you cannot control our registrar: there is no Wi-Fi in it, for Wi-Fi you should go to more advanced (and more expensive) BlackVue models.
Turn on the recorder with the inserted flash drive - and the BlackVue Viewer is copied to the media from the device's memory. Then the flash drive can be inserted into the card reader on the PC, after which we will get access to the BlackVue Viewer. In it you can change the following.
• select the duration of the recording in cyclic mode - 1, 2 or 3 minutes; • select the duration of the recording in the parking mode - 1, 2 or 3 minutes; • select video resolution (Full HD, 15 or 30 fps; HD, 15 or 30 fps); • adjust video brightness; • set the image quality (of course, you should choose the “highest”); • include date, time and user text stamps on the video; • turn on sound recording; • set automatic activation of the parking mode; • adjust the accelerometer sensitivity, including according to data from any particular video, which I personally have never seen before. Very convenient! • customize the operation of LED indicators; • set up voice notifications; • view the video by sorting the videos by event type (normal cyclic recording, recording according to the “instructions” of the accelerometer, recording according to the motion sensor in the parking mode). Viewing is possible with imposing on Google Maps - for this, in fact, you need a GPS, as well as to determine the exact time and speed.
As mentioned above, there are three recording modes in the B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S. On a regular loop recording, you can only say that the clips are written overlap, that is, in each new video there is the last second of the old one.
Files created in the event mode, that is, on the “order” of the accelerometer, include 5 seconds before the incident - impact, sudden braking, turning and so on. Such files are placed in a special zone on the memory card and are not deleted during the cyclic rewriting.
Well, and the third type of recording: by motion sensor, that is, when a certain object appears in the field of view of the camera in the parking mode. There is one important nuance here: in the case of B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S, for recording in parking mode with the engine turned off, you need to purchase an accessory Power Magic Pro for 3,000 rubles, which allows you to turn on the recorder directly into the electrical system of the car. Because there is no battery in the B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S, there is only a supercapacitor, which I will discuss below.

But on the video of the developers did not save a single Won. The model uses a Sony Exmor matrix with a resolution of 2 megapixels, which is more than enough to record Full HD video. The lens is made of professional glass with an enlightened coating and has a viewing angle of 118 degrees, that is, the standard for recorders. Although, of course, at night the distance of readability of numbers is smaller: not 17-20 meters, as during the day, but only 12-15. But even this is a lot compared to even expensive (up to 15 thousand) Chinese recorders, who “issue” 8-10 meters at night. A third less!
Of the minuses explained by Korean specifics, it is worth noting the lack of a BlackVue DR450-1CH GPS battery. There is only a super-capacitor that allows you to complete the recording in case of an accident, when the recorder may lose contact with the on-board electrical system of the car. However, the supercapacitor has one indisputable advantage: it allows you to start recording without any problems at temperatures up to minus 15 in the cold cabin of the car. Registrars with familiar batteries in such situations often succumb until the salon “freezes” (which is about 10 minutes), since lithium-polymer batteries are very afraid of cold weather.
